CVE-2024-11165

Source
https://cve.org/CVERecord?id=CVE-2024-11165
Import Source
https://storage.googleapis.com/osv-test-cve-osv-conversion/osv-output/CVE-2024-11165.json
JSON Data
https://api.test.osv.dev/v1/vulns/CVE-2024-11165
Published
2024-11-13T15:15:06.877Z
Modified
2026-02-06T04:58:49.321346Z
Severity
  • 5.7 (Medium) CVSS_V4 - CVSS:4.0/AV:L/AC:H/AT:N/PR:H/UI:N/VC:L/VI:H/VA:L/SC:L/SI:L/SA:L/E:X/CR:X/IR:X/AR:X/MAV:X/MAC:X/MAT:X/MPR:X/MUI:X/MVC:X/MVI:X/MVA:X/MSC:X/MSI:X/MSA:X/S:X/AU:X/R:X/V:X/RE:X/U:X CVSS Calculator
Summary
[none]
Details

An information disclosure vulnerability exists in the backup configuration process where the SAS token is not masked in the configuration response. This oversight results in sensitive information leakage within the yb_backup log files, exposing the SAS token in plaintext. The leakage occurs during the backup procedure, leading to potential unauthorized access to resources associated with the SAS token. This issue affects YugabyteDB Anywhere: from 2.20.0.0 before 2.20.7.0, from 2.23.0.0 before 2.23.1.0, from 2024.1.0.0 before 2024.1.3.0.

References

Affected packages

Git / github.com/yugabyte/yugabyte-db

Database specific

vanir_signatures
[
    {
        "signature_type": "Line",
        "source": "https://github.com/yugabyte/yugabyte-db/commit/6acbaf1283d6ce33f0f401725814c8930d3f8a3f",
        "target": {
            "file": "src/yb/integration-tests/cdcsdk_ysql_test_base.cc"
        },
        "id": "CVE-2024-11165-1c5c4c77",
        "signature_version": "v1",
        "digest": {
            "threshold": 0.9,
            "line_hashes": [
                "69179067894327887912844943950513610569",
                "62632090007202468744299428039733670264",
                "314606144803636029966044588341940063793",
                "97341136238648283649026300297949680293",
                "266944137342694237301420719683804269017",
                "142297340080821180874701275917071130179",
                "112507651040781896521797591805218505136",
                "102178576102451292256067002058568799021"
            ]
        },
        "deprecated": false
    },
    {
        "signature_type": "Function",
        "source": "https://github.com/yugabyte/yugabyte-db/commit/6acbaf1283d6ce33f0f401725814c8930d3f8a3f",
        "target": {
            "file": "src/yb/integration-tests/cdcsdk_ysql_test_base.cc",
            "function": "CDCSDKYsqlTest::WaitForPostApplyMetadataWritten"
        },
        "id": "CVE-2024-11165-1d2791ba",
        "signature_version": "v1",
        "digest": {
            "function_hash": "61304604467114724231489717524990766445",
            "length": 886.0
        },
        "deprecated": false
    },
    {
        "signature_type": "Line",
        "source": "https://github.com/yugabyte/yugabyte-db/commit/920989b6c0db0222bb7a0cce46febc76cf72d438",
        "target": {
            "file": "managed/src/main/java/com/yugabyte/yw/common/ShellProcessHandler.java"
        },
        "id": "CVE-2024-11165-3fe1f94c",
        "signature_version": "v1",
        "digest": {
            "threshold": 0.9,
            "line_hashes": [
                "196041372898236340686335589231938670747",
                "131075429662908264668190491353274628598",
                "84555700480089779124505223057917525049",
                "315847396071988782869994075830582364181",
                "94673477679613222879243163958524411487",
                "116028006802619572837400288036353881798",
                "232992680403884518839918512502675787404",
                "253132588235428297568520772581838043711",
                "202648119804378110516992296278774133362",
                "56910806000445708209451832989797284054"
            ]
        },
        "deprecated": false
    },
    {
        "signature_type": "Line",
        "source": "https://github.com/yugabyte/yugabyte-db/commit/920989b6c0db0222bb7a0cce46febc76cf72d438",
        "target": {
            "file": "managed/src/main/java/com/yugabyte/yw/common/RedactingService.java"
        },
        "id": "CVE-2024-11165-709153e3",
        "signature_version": "v1",
        "digest": {
            "threshold": 0.9,
            "line_hashes": [
                "147621093176143635454504968402903978383",
                "248283436587404583533702912523403419212",
                "48327759621158085349962003639301742086",
                "31687782737386939571213277719569464106",
                "110627420113301928137305202696943976440",
                "21705508086916072231457960561396034328"
            ]
        },
        "deprecated": false
    },
    {
        "signature_type": "Line",
        "source": "https://github.com/yugabyte/yugabyte-db/commit/920989b6c0db0222bb7a0cce46febc76cf72d438",
        "target": {
            "file": "managed/src/main/java/com/yugabyte/yw/models/helpers/CommonUtils.java"
        },
        "id": "CVE-2024-11165-838f19b4",
        "signature_version": "v1",
        "digest": {
            "threshold": 0.9,
            "line_hashes": [
                "267338190211758997925077320247750295157",
                "19666263487459571122552353248540254172",
                "304711392501483673228880743863755313901",
                "99280448483130150238149444438763310085"
            ]
        },
        "deprecated": false
    },
    {
        "signature_type": "Line",
        "source": "https://github.com/yugabyte/yugabyte-db/commit/6acbaf1283d6ce33f0f401725814c8930d3f8a3f",
        "target": {
            "file": "src/yb/tablet/transaction_participant.cc"
        },
        "id": "CVE-2024-11165-9a991ed0",
        "signature_version": "v1",
        "digest": {
            "threshold": 0.9,
            "line_hashes": [
                "118191393160726067434713943001141879471",
                "46171788352154076957205854285512365245",
                "312608642798048294930796893405647436073",
                "217624878082735707317385964167046162870"
            ]
        },
        "deprecated": false
    },
    {
        "signature_type": "Function",
        "source": "https://github.com/yugabyte/yugabyte-db/commit/920989b6c0db0222bb7a0cce46febc76cf72d438",
        "target": {
            "file": "managed/src/main/java/com/yugabyte/yw/common/ShellProcessHandler.java",
            "function": "getOutputLines"
        },
        "id": "CVE-2024-11165-d937a3b2",
        "signature_version": "v1",
        "digest": {
            "function_hash": "316219674943065466410076554175449720577",
            "length": 461.0
        },
        "deprecated": false
    },
    {
        "signature_type": "Line",
        "source": "https://github.com/yugabyte/yugabyte-db/commit/6acbaf1283d6ce33f0f401725814c8930d3f8a3f",
        "target": {
            "file": "src/yb/tablet/tablet_bootstrap.cc"
        },
        "id": "CVE-2024-11165-f2ccf6ad",
        "signature_version": "v1",
        "digest": {
            "threshold": 0.9,
            "line_hashes": [
                "127408575875813910990999087701724863600",
                "243449743797406210735496558378245324576",
                "203259259799840998722605634777905663733",
                "112809946461783654759815586232372389921"
            ]
        },
        "deprecated": false
    }
]
source
"https://storage.googleapis.com/osv-test-cve-osv-conversion/osv-output/CVE-2024-11165.json"